Movavi Apple TV Video Converter Review: Fastest Software With Highly Customizable Interface

Movavi Apple TV Video Converter is the one click solution for conversion of all the DVD and video files to the Apple TV video formats. Brought to you by the Movavi, this is one of the fastest software of its kind. Its easy to use interface can give rise to excellent video and audio output files.

Movavi Apple TV Video Converter is fully compatible to the Dual-Core processors. You can convert the DVD files (VOB) and other video files like MPEG, DAT, AVI, MPG, WMV, MOV, RMVB, RM, DivX, 3GP, ASF file etc to the Apple TV compatible MP4 and MPEG-4 formats. Not only that, its another feature is the conversion of popular audio files like WMA, OGG, MP2, RA, AC3, CDA and APE files to Apple TV compatible MP3, AAC and WAV formats.

Movavi Apple TV Video Converter supports batch conversion technology. The trimming function can cut down the unwanted large file. You have to set the ‘start point’ and the ‘end point’. The software will rip the desired file length only. This is applicable for both the audio and the video files.
Highly customizable interface includes adjustment mode for brightness, contrast, volume and others. You can also set the video aspect ratio (16:9, 4:3). The crop mode helps you to cut the black edges around the converted video file. It will help you see in the full screen mode in Apple TV. You can even rotate the output video by 90, 180 and 270 degrees.

This Movavi Apple TV Video Converter is available in the market with US$ 29.95. Considering the rate and the features, my rating is 9 out of 10.
